By Adedayo Akinwale

The Minister of Foreign Affairs, Mr. Geoffrey Onyeama resumed work yesterday after testing negative to COVID-19 pandemic.

Onyeama who had been in isolation for three weeks initially had throat irritation, which forced him to go for COVID-19 test the fourth time and came back positive.

He had tweeted: “Did my fourth COVID-19 test yesterday at the first sign of a throat irritation and unfortunately this time it came back positive. That is life! Win some lose some – heading for isolation in a health facility and praying for the best.”

The minister announced the latest COVID-19 result yesterday in his verified Twitter handle.

Onyeama tweeted: “By the very special grace of God my latest #COVID19 test result came back negative after three weeks isolation.

“I am eternally grateful to my family, the Commander –in- Chief, President Muhammadu Buhari, and Vice President Yemi Osinbajo, the medical team, relations, friends, colleagues, religious leaders and numerous well-wishers, who through their care, prayers, fasting, messages of support and encouragement never let me walk alone.”
